    How does the law define Common Parts regarding mechanical equipment?

    Ali Faizan Syed1 min read0 viewsUpdated 1/2/2026
    Mechanical systems that serve the building's infrastructure are legally protected as Common Parts. This category includes elevators, water tanks, pipes, and generators. It also encompasses chimneys, ventilation fans, ducts, air compressor units, and entire mechanical ventilation systems. These components are essential for the building's habitability and safety. Because they serve the property collectively, their maintenance and repair costs are typically covered by the Service Charges paid by all owners, and they are managed by the building's appointed Management Entity.
